    We went for the winter market and while it was raining a bit, the market experience did not disappoint. It was a beautiful, postcard perfect, little town square with one building having an advent on the side of its walls - it is famed as being the largest advent calendar in Europe and they are probably right - watching them open one of the doors was great. The food, drink, and other items for sale as well as the atmosphere were fantastic. My family are big fans of winter markets and this one rates in our Top 5. We also walked up to the ruins of the castle overlooking the town - great view of the town and river. If you love Asian food, you must try Dian's - some of the best food I have eaten including having lived in SE Asia for 6 years.

    The beautiful medieval town of Bernkastel is almost complete and exceedingly well maintained. Plenty eating places, lively vibe, great for walking if fit (hills and vineyards and forest) but flat walking or cycling along the riverside was beautiful. Also an unexpected pleasure was museum Zylinderhaus & restaurant . Walked down from the castle to a lovely lunch at the Schutzenhaus with a stunning balcony view of the Mosel.

    Charming little town on the river Mosel. Because of it’s size the town itself is good for maximum 1 day of sightseeing but deserves at least one night to stay. Though it is a lovely starting point or base to see the area along the River Mosel, with interesting places such as Cochem, Trier, Burg Eltz, Traben Trarbach, Beilstein, Saarburg or even Luxemburg.
